Simple Price Index Orange Formula and Mathematical Explanation

The simple price index orange formula calculates the relative change in orange prices between two periods. The mathematical foundation of simple price index orange calculations follows standard price index methodology, comparing current prices to a base period to determine percentage changes over time.

The step-by-step derivation of the simple price index orange formula begins with establishing a base year price of oranges as the reference point (typically set to 100). The current year price is then compared to this base, with the ratio multiplied by 100 to create the price index. For the simple price index orange calculation, the formula becomes: Price Index = (Current Price ÷ Base Price) × 100. The inflation rate is derived by subtracting 100 from the price index, giving the percentage increase in orange prices.

Practical Examples (Real-World Use Cases)

Example 1: Food Industry Pricing Analysis

A food processing company uses simple price index orange calculations to adjust their citrus product pricing. In 2020, oranges cost $1.80 per pound, but by 2023, prices rose to $2.40 per pound. Using the simple price index orange method, they calculate: Price Index = ($2.40 ÷ $1.80) × 100 = 133.33. The inflation rate is 33.33%, indicating significant cost increases that require adjustments to their product pricing strategy.

Example 2: Consumer Budget Planning

A family uses simple price index orange calculations to understand food inflation impacts on their grocery budget. If oranges cost $2.20 per pound in 2021 and $2.75 per pound in 2023, the simple price index orange shows: Price Index = ($2.75 ÷ $2.20) × 100 = 125.00. With a 25% inflation rate, they can better plan their food budget knowing that orange prices have increased significantly, potentially affecting their overall grocery expenses.

Key Factors That Affect Simple Price Index Orange Results

  1. Weather Conditions: Climate variations significantly impact orange harvest yields, affecting supply and prices. Droughts, freezes, or excessive rain can reduce orange production, leading to higher prices and elevated simple price index orange values.
  2. Seasonal Demand Patterns: Orange consumption fluctuates seasonally, with higher demand during winter months for vitamin C. These seasonal variations influence the simple price index orange calculations throughout the year.
  3. Transportation Costs: Fuel prices and shipping logistics affect orange distribution costs. Higher transportation expenses increase retail prices, contributing to higher simple price index orange measurements.
  4. Currency Exchange Rates: For imported oranges, currency fluctuations impact pricing. A weaker local currency makes imported oranges more expensive, increasing simple price index orange values.
  5. Market Competition: The number of orange suppliers and competitive pricing strategies influence retail prices. Less competition may lead to higher prices and elevated simple price index orange readings.
  6. Government Policies: Agricultural subsidies, import tariffs, and trade agreements affect orange prices. Policy changes can significantly impact simple price index orange calculations.
  7. Storage and Preservation Technology: Advances in cold storage and preservation extend orange shelf life, affecting supply and pricing. Better technology can stabilize prices and moderate simple price index orange fluctuations.
  8. Economic Recession: During economic downturns, consumer spending patterns shift, potentially reducing orange demand and affecting simple price index orange calculations.

What’s the difference between simple price index orange and weighted price indices?

The simple price index orange tracks only orange prices, while weighted indices consider multiple items with different importance levels. Simple price index orange is easier to calculate but less representative of overall food inflation.

Does simple price index orange account for quality differences?

Basic simple price index orange calculations don’t account for quality differences. More sophisticated versions would need to adjust for grade, variety, and other quality factors affecting orange prices.
